Nancy Mason Obituary

Nancy Kitchen Mason

November 18, 1935 - August 31, 2024

MASON, Nancy K. of Richmond passed away peacefully on Saturday, August 31, 2024 at the age of 88. She was born on November 18, 1935, the youngest daughter of William Bentley Kitchen and Viola Woodfin Kitchen. She was preceded in death by her husband of 29 years, Morris Elsworth Mason. She is survived by her eldest son, Robert Morris Mason and his wife Jane Scott (Scottie) Evans Mason, her youngest son, Kenneth Allen Mason and his wife Tara Lawson Mason and her step-daughter, April Karen Mason and her husband Patrick Jasper Lambeth; her seven grandchildren, Evan Robert Mason, Anna Scott Mason, Siena Elizabeth Mason, Riley Elise Mason, Marc Allen Singleton, Charles Wesley Major and Samuel Mason Major; her three great grandchildren, Levi Mason Major, Liam James Major and Harper Mae Singleton.

She was a wonderful mother, grandmother, sister, daughter and wife and a reliable friend to so so many. She devoted a large part of her adult life to raising her children and being actively involved in their lives. For over 40 years, she was a faithful, dedicated member of Beulah Methodist Church. During her career, she served as the legal secretary for her husband for many years, and after his passing, she took an administrative position with Chesterfield County Animal Control Department. For fun, Nancy loved to travel and she had quite the adventurous spirit, being fortunate to travel to Italy, Alaska, Hawaii, Mexico, Jamaica and many other lesser exotic locations. She so loved nature, gardening, hummingbirds and especially spending time with her grandchildren.

Her remains rest at the Morrissett Funeral Home located at 6500 Iron Bridge Road in Chesterfield, Va, where the family will receive friends on Tuesday, September 17, from 10 a.m. to 12 p.m. with the funeral service immediately following at the Morrissett Chapel. A private graveside service for family only will be held at 1:30 p.m. that afternoon at the Sunset Memorial Park Cemetery, located at 2901 West Hundred Road in Chester, Va.
